Job description

Location: London, WC2H 8NU

Salary: £50,000 per annum plus Sodexo benefits

Contract: 40 hours per week, Monday to Friday

About the Role

This is an exciting opportunity to join the team at NBCUniversal’s Headquarters in London, playing a pivotal role in ensuring statutory and technical compliance across a high-profile, complex estate.

As Technical Compliance Manager, you will lead statutory maintenance compliance, manage risk, and drive best-in-class standards across all sites. You’ll work closely with site teams, subcontractors, and senior stakeholders, providing assurance, insight, and leadership to maintain a safe, compliant, and audit-ready operation at all times.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ead and report on statutory maintenance compliance across the whole estate
  • Hold site teams to account for statutory and non-statutory work order compliance
  • Identify, manage, and mitigate statutory and operational risks
  • Proactively close out actions from internal audits, external audits, and statutory inspections
  • Maintain accurate asset registers, inventories, and full asset lifecycle data
  • Ensure continuous audit readiness across all sites
  • Maintain physical and digital compliance logbooks and ensure CAFM compliance
  • Ensure policies, procedures, and initiatives are implemented to minimise operational risk and improve performance
  • Provide clear, data-driven reporting to support client decision-making
  • Support and challenge teams constructively, with humility and professionalism
What You’ll Be Accountable For
  • Achieving and maintaining 100% statutory compliance across the estate
  • Providing actionable insights that reduce asset risk, liability, and cost of ownership
  • Acting as a subject matter expert in technical and statutory compliance
  • Delivering high-quality monthly compliance reporting and assurance
  • Success measured through audit outcomes, compliance performance, and client feedback
Skills, Knowledge & Experience
  • Extensive experience in statutory compliance within the built environment
  • Strong knowledge of CMMS/CAFM systems and SFG20 maintenance standards
  • Working towards (or holding) professional membership such as CIOB, RICS, CIBSE, or IWFM
  • Confident user of Microsoft O365, with the ability to produce high-quality documentation
  • Excellent communicator and presenter, comfortable engaging at all levels
  • Highly organised, adaptable, and able to manage multiple priorities
  • Collaborative, proactive, and flexible in approach
  • Willingness to travel as required
